### Changelog — TumbleKey v3.2

Changed defaults for the locker access flow. Grace period shortened, retry limits tightened after the Dellhurst incident. PIN fallback now off by default. Existing deployments keep old values unless re-provisioned. For the sync: new installs pick up the defaults shown below.

service settings:
PRAIX_LOG_LEVEL=error
PRAIX_METRICS_HOST=metrics.praix.qorvelcorp.corp
PRAIX_POOL_SIZE=16

### LiftSim Dispatch — Restart Procedure

Before restarting the Cartwheel elevator-dispatch simulator, drain any in-flight hall calls and confirm the scenario scheduler has paused. A restart mid-scenario corrupts the trip ledger and invalidates the morning benchmark run. Once drained, stop the service, clear the scratch cache, and bring it back up. On startup it loads the following configuration values:

deployment values, yadug-bawif:
[framir]
team = pelox
access_code = ac_a38ab2
owner = tamion.julael
host = framir.tolvaqlabs.test
port = 11211
peer = tammir.zemvargrid.local
salt = 2215ef03
pin = 1541

**Item 14 — Crash-report pipeline (Pebbleline iOS/Android).** Confirm symbol upload completed for both store builds. Verify crash ingestion shows nonzero events from the canary cohort within 30 minutes of rollout. If ingestion is silent, halt the ramp and page mobile infra. Record the verified pipeline run in the release log. The trace token for this check follows.

pipeline stamp: htk3_69f

## 3.2.0 — Changed defaults

The Corvel matching service was hitting 400ms GC pauses under burst load, breaking match deadlines. Defaults now use the low-pause collector with a smaller young generation and pre-touched heap. Pause p99 dropped to 18ms in soak tests. Override only with a benchmark attached. New defaults are as follows.

deployment values, kajep-kageg:
[praix]
host = praix.paliqcorp.corp
user = praix_svc
database = praix_prod

**Q: What's the status of the Beaconleaf consent banner rollout?**

A: The banner is live for 25% of traffic in the Veldora region and will expand weekly. Dismissal events are logged to the consent pipeline; dashboards update hourly. Known issue: the banner briefly flashes on cached pages, fix is in review. If your team sees layout regressions or missing consent events, report them to the rollout owners at the address below.

escalation mailbox, bafog-fafog: ulador@paliqlabs.internal